A Boon for Baby Boomers - Robots to Assist Healthcare Practitioners

As our baby boomers enter into their golden years, the demand for healthcare is shooting up faster than the number of quality nursing, physical therapy, and occupational therapy graduates. Now, more than ever, we need the help of technology to fill in the gap.

At the Healthcare Robotics Lab at Georgia Tech, researchers there focus on developing autonomous robots as well as finding ways to improve human-robot interaction. This bunch of brilliant individuals come from three main fields: Biomedical Engineering, Interactive Computing, and Electrical and Computer Engineering.
